Jumuah – the special offer you shouldn’t refuse

Jumuah

Adam was created and mankind’s earthly existence will end

Abu Hurayrah (may Allah be pleased with him) reported God’s Messenger (peace be upon him) as saying:

وعن أبي هريرة رضي الله عنه قال : قال رسول الله صلى الله عليه وسلم : ( خَيْرُ يَوْمٍ طَلَعَتْ عَلَيْهِ الشَّمْسُ يَوْمُ الْجُمُعَةِ ، فِيهِ خُلِقَ آدَمُ ، وَفِيهِ أُدْخِلَ الْجَنَّةَ ، وَفِيهِ أُخْرِجَ مِنْهَا ) . رواه مسلم (1410) .

“The best day on which the sun has risen is Friday; on it Adam was created, on it he was brought into paradise, on it he was expelled from it, and the last hour will take place on no day other than Friday.” [Muslim]

Aus bin Aus reported God’s Messenger (peace be upon him) as saying:

وعن أوس بن أوس : عن النبي صلى الله عليه وسلم قال : ( إِنَّ مِنْ أَفْضَلِ أَيَّامِكُمْ يَوْمَ الْجُمُعَةِ ، فِيهِ خُلِقَ آدَمُ عَلَيْهِ السَّلَام ، وَفِيهِ قُبِضَ ، وَفِيهِ النَّفْخَةُ ، وَفِيهِ الصَّعْقَةُ ، فَأَكْثِرُوا عَلَيَّ مِنْ الصَّلَاةِ فَإِنَّ صَلَاتَكُمْ مَعْرُوضَةٌ عَلَيَّ ، قَالُوا : يَا رَسُولَ اللَّهِ ، وَكَيْفَ تُعْرَضُ صَلاتُنَا عَلَيْكَ وَقَدْ أَرَمْتَ -أَيْ يَقُولُونَ قَدْ بَلِيتَ- قَالَ : إِنَّ اللَّهَ عَزَّ وَجَلَّ قَدْ حَرَّمَ عَلَى الأَرْضِ أَنْ تَأْكُلَ أَجْسَادَ الأَنْبِيَاءِ عَلَيْهِمْ السَّلام ) . رواه أبو داود (1047) وصححه ابن القيم في تعليقه على سنن أبي داود (4/273) . وصححه الألباني في صحيح أبي داود (925) .

“Among the most excellent of your days is Friday; on it Adam was created, on it he died, on it the last trumpet will be blown, and on it the shout will be made, so invoke many blessings on me that day, for your blessing will be presented to me.” He was asked how that could be when his body had decayed and replied, “God has prohibited the earth from consuming the bodies of prophets.” (Abu Dawud, Nasa’i, Ibn Majah, Darimi and Baihaqi, in [Kitab] ad-Da‘awat al-Kabir)

From this narration we see that the day of Jumuah was the day that Adam was created and the day the Trumpet will be blown and Adam (mankind) will die and his existence on earth will come to an end.

Sharing his knowledge with his (peace be upon him) Ummah

In the same narration the Prophet (peace be upon him) said that people should increase sending blessings on him on Jumuah. He is, out of his mercy, enlightening us, by sharing with us knowledge of the hidden blessings in this day, of which would not otherwise be aware nor take advantage. The Prophet (peace be upon him) was giving us insight into this time so that we could maximise our benefit and increase our good deeds on that day aware that it is a special day.

In another hadith, we see that there are 5 reasons that make Jumuah special. Abu Lubabah bin ‘Abdul-Mundhir (may Allah be pleased with him) narrated that the Prophet (ﷺ) said:

وعَنْ أَبِي لُبَابَةَ بْنِ عَبْدِ الْمُنْذِرِ قَالَ : قَالَ النَّبِيُّ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 : ( إِنَّ يَوْمَ الْجُمُعَةِ سَيِّدُ الأَيَّامِ ، وَأَعْظَمُهَا عِنْدَ اللَّهِ ، وَهُوَ أَعْظَمُ عِنْدَ اللَّهِ مِنْ يَوْمِ الأَضْحَى وَيَوْمِ الْفِطْرِ ، فِيهِ خَمْسُ خِلالٍ :

١-خَلَقَ اللَّهُ فِيهِ آدَمَ ،

٢-وَأَهْبَطَ اللَّهُ فِيهِ آدَمَ إِلَى الأَرْضِ ،

٣-وَفِيهِ تَوَفَّى اللَّهُ آدَمَ ،

٤-وَفِيهِ سَاعَةٌ لا يَسْأَلُ اللَّهَ فِيهَا الْعَبْدُ شَيْئًا إِلا أَعْطَاهُ ، مَا لَمْ يَسْأَلْ حَرَامًا ،

٥-وَفِيهِ تَقُومُ السَّاعَةُ ، مَا مِنْ مَلَكٍ مُقَرَّبٍ وَلا سَمَاءٍ وَلا أَرْضٍ وَلا رِيَاحٍ وَلا جِبَالٍ وَلا بَحْرٍ إِلا وَهُنَّ يُشْفِقْنَ مِنْ يَوْمِ الْجُمُعَةِ ) . رواه ابن ماجه (1084) . وحسَّنه الشيخ الألباني في صحيح الجامع رقم (2279) .

‘Friday is the chief of days, the greatest day before Allah. It is greater before Allah then the Day of Adha and the Day of Fitr. It has five characteristics:

1 On it Allah created Adam

2 On it Allah sent down Adam to this earth

4 On it Adam passed away

5 On it there is a time during which a person does not ask Allah for anything but He will give it to him, so long as he does not ask for anything that is forbidden

4 On it the Hour will begin. There is no angel who is close to Allah, no heaven, no earth, no wind, no mountain, and no sea that does not fear Friday.’” [Ibn Majah]

Scholars wondered why it is a virtue that Adam was expelled from Jannah on Jumuah. They decided that this was a virtue because had Adam not been expelled from Jannah, the progeny of Adam would not have been born. The human race – including the prophets and messengers and the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him) – would not have come into existence.

The Final Hour is a virtue because that is when Allah will reward the righteous and punish the wicked. This is why the day of Jumuah is special.

Jumuah is even better than Eid

In another narration we are told that the day of Jummuah is better than Eid and the prayer of Eid, as the prayer of Jumuah is fard whereas Eid prayer is only sunnah (as per the Shafi madhab) or wajib in the Hanafi school).

Jumuah is an exclusive blessing for Muslims as previous nations rejected it

It is beautiful that Allah Almighty guided us to this day, while the previous nations, the Jews and Christians were not given it. The collection of narrations on this topic show that the day was presented to the previous nations but they did not take it. For instance when it was told to Musa (peace be upon him) his people contested why Jumuah was special rather than Saturday and they did not accept it. Therefore Saturday was approved for them and missed out on the blessings of Friday, meanwhile, Christians preferred Sunday, so Muslims came last but our sacred day comes before the sabbath of the Jews and Christians, as Saturday and Sunday come after.

Abu Hurayrah (may Allah be pleased with him) reported God’s Messenger (peace be upon him) as saying:

وَفِي رِوَايَة لمُسلم عَن أبي هُرَيْرَة وَعَنْ حُذَيْفَةَ قَالَا: قَالَ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 فِي آخِرِ الْحَدِيثِ: «نَحْنُ الْآخِرُونَ مِنْ أَهْلِ الدُّنْيَا وَالْأَوَّلُونَ يَوْمَ الْقِيَامَةِ الْمقْضِي لَهُم قبل الْخَلَائق» متفق عليه.

“We who are last shall be first on the day of resurrection, although [others] were given the Book before us and we were given it after them. It follows that this was their day which was prescribed for them (meaning Friday), but they disagreed about it and God guided us to it. The people come after us with regard to it, the Jews observing the next day and the Christians the day following that.” [Bukhari and Muslim]

“We who are last shall be first on the day of resurrection, and we shall be the first to enter paradise although [others] . . .”, and he mentioned something similar up to the end. In another version by him from Abu Hurayrah and Hudhaifa they reported God’s Messenger as saying at the end of the tradition, “We are the last of the people in this world and shall be the first on the day of resurrection, this being decreed for us before all creatures.” [Muslim]

Abu Hurayrah and Hurayrah that the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) said:

عن أبي هريرة وحذيفة رضي الله عنهما قالا : قال رسول الله صلى الله عليه وسلم : ( أَضَلَّ اللَّهُ عَنْ الْجُمُعَةِ مَنْ كَانَ قَبْلَنَا ، فَكَانَ لِلْيَهُودِ يَوْمُ السَّبْتِ ، وَكَانَ لِلنَّصَارَى يَوْمُ الأَحَدِ ، فَجَاءَ اللَّهُ بِنَا فَهَدَانَا اللَّهُ لِيَوْمِ الْجُمُعَةِ ، فَجَعَلَ الْجُمُعَةَ وَالسَّبْتَ وَالأَحَدَ ، وَكَذَلِكَ هُمْ تَبَعٌ لَنَا يَوْمَ الْقِيَامَةِ ، نَحْنُ الآخِرُونَ مِنْ أَهْلِ الدُّنْيَا ، وَالأَوَّلُونَ يَوْمَ الْقِيَامَةِ ، الْمَقْضِيُّ لَهُمْ قَبْلَ الْخَلائِقِ ) . رواه مسلم (856) .

It was Friday from which Allah diverted those who were before us. For the Jews (the day set aside for prayer) was Sabt (Saturday), and for the Christians it was Sunday. And Allah turned towards us and guided us to Friday (as the day of prayer) for us. In fact, He (Allah) made Friday, Saturday and Sunday (as days of prayer). In this order would they (Jews and Christians) come after us on the Day of Resurrection. We are the last of (the Ummahs) among the people in this world and the first among the created to be judged on the Day of Resurrection. In one narration it is: ‘, to be judged among them”. [Muslim]

Not only is there special reward but the special hour, in which when you ask for anything from Allah and He responds to you, (of course these should not be haram things). Scholars have tried to figure out when this hour is and they think it is in the last hour before Maghrib. It is known as Sa’atul Ijaba.

The time for accepted duas is an hour before Maghrib on Jumuah

Jabir ibn Abdullah (may Allah be pleased with him) narrated that the Prophet (ﷺ) said:

وروى أبو داود والنسائي عن جابر عن النبي – صلى الله عليه وسلم – قال: «يوم الجمعة اثنتا عشرة ساعةً، فيها ساعة لا يوجد مسلمٌ يسأل الله فيها شيئًا إلا أعطاه، فالتمِسوها آخرَ ساعة بعد العصر».

Friday is divided into twelve hours. Amongst them there is an hour in which a Muslim does not ask Allah for anything but He gives it to him. So seek it in the last hour after the Asr prayer. [Abu Dawoud]

Jumuah is a cleansing agent

The Prophet (peace be upon him) taught us that the day of Jumuah is like a cleansing agent, which cleanses your soul, your body, your actions and your deeds, deleting your minor sins for the week. It boosts your reward, topping up your account in the Hereafter.

Abu Hurayrah reported God’s Messenger as saying,

وَعَنْ أَبِي هُرَيْرَةَ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 قَالَ: قَالَ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: «الصَّلَوَاتُ الْخَمْسُ وَالْجُمُعَةُ إِلَى الْجُمُعَةِ وَرَمَضَانُ إِلَى رَمَضَانَ مُكَفِّرَاتٌ لَمَّا بَيْنَهُنَّ إِذَا اجْتُنِبَتِ الْكَبَائِر» . رَوَاهُ مُسلم.

 “The five [daily] prayers, Friday to Friday and Ramadan to Ramadan make expiation for what has happened since the previous one when major sins have been avoided.” [Muslim]

Don’t let business distract you from Jumuah – that is a lose lose situation

Jumuah is therefore full of virtues and blessings. Let’s treat Jumuah as a special day, rather than prioritising our business on Fridays. That is why we have been taught to rush to catch the prayer.

  يَا أَيُّهَا الَّذِينَ آمَنُوا إِذَا نُودِي لِلصَّلاةِ مِنْ يَوْمِ الْجُمُعَةِ فَاسْعَوْا إِلَى ذِكْرِ اللَّهِ وَذَرُوا الْبَيْعَ ذَلِكُمْ خَيْرٌ لَكُمْ إِنْ كُنتُمْ تَعْلَمُونَ

O you who believe! When the call is made for prayer on Congregation Day, hasten to the remembrance of God, and drop all business. That is better for you, if you only knew. [62:9]

It is haram for men to work during the time of Jumuah and whatever you earn during that time will be haram. Jumuah is not like any other day of the week. The mercy of Allah envelops us that day.
